Step 1: Assessment and Planning

We'll start by assessing the damage and creating a customized plan to restore your property to its original condition. This may involve removing standing water, drying out affected areas, and repairing or replacing damaged materials.

Step 2: Water Removal and Drying

Using our advanced water extraction equipment, we'll remove as much water as possible from the affected area. We'll then use our drying equipment to dry out the space, including walls, floors, and ceilings.

Step 3: Cleaning and Sanitizing

We'll use specialized cleaning products and equipment to remove any remaining moisture and contaminants from the affected area. This is crucial for preventing mold growth and ensuring your property is safe and healthy.

Step 4: Repair and Reconstruction

Once the area is dry and clean, we'll repair or replace any damaged materials, including drywall, flooring, and cabinets. We'll work with you to ensure that the final result meets your needs and budget.

Step 5: Final Inspection and Cleanup

We'll conduct a final inspection to ensure that the job is complete and to your satisfaction. We'll also clean up any debris or equipment left behind, leaving your property looking like new.

Water Damage Restoration Cost in Wittmann, AZ

The cost of water damage restoration in Wittmann, AZ, can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our estimates are free and based on a thorough assessment of your property. Here are some typical price ranges for common services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and drying $500 - $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age
Repair or replacement of damaged materials $1,000 - $5,000 Materials needed, labor required
Mold remediation $500 - $2,000 Size of affected area, severity of mold growth
Disinfection and cleaning $200 - $1,000 Size of affected area, level of contamination
Final inspection and cleanup $100 - $500 Size of affected area, level of debris

Common Questions About Water Damage Restoration

How long does water damage restoration take?

The length of time required for water damage restoration depends on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area. In general, we can complete a typical restoration job within 3-5 days.

Is water damage restoration covered by insurance?

Yes, water damage restoration is typically covered by homeowners' insurance policies. But, the specifics of your policy will depend on your provider and coverage.

Can I try to dry out the area myself?

While it's tempting to try to dry out the area yourself, it's not recommended. Without proper equipment and expertise, you may end up causing further damage or creating a safety hazard.

How do I prevent water damage in the future?

Preventing water damage needs regular maintenance and inspections. Check your pipes, appliances, and roof regularly for signs of damage or wear. Also, consider installing a water sensor or leak detector to alert you to potential problems.
